Understanding 0.6 - 1kv YJV Cables

Before we discuss weather - resistance, let's briefly understand what 0.6 - 1kv YJV cables are. YJV cables are cross - linked polyethylene insulated PVC sheathed power cables. The "0.6 - 1kv" indicates the voltage range within which these cables are designed to operate safely. They are widely used in power transmission and distribution systems, such as in buildings, industrial plants, and infrastructure projects.

Factors Affecting Weather - Resistance

Material Composition

The materials used in the construction of 0.6 - 1kv YJV cables play a crucial role in their weather - resistance. The cross - linked polyethylene (XLPE) insulation is known for its excellent electrical properties and chemical stability. It has good resistance to water, ozone, and ultraviolet (UV) radiation. The PVC sheath, on the other hand, provides mechanical protection and additional resistance to environmental factors.

Design and Manufacturing Process

The design and manufacturing process also impact the weather - resistance of the cables. High - quality manufacturing ensures proper insulation thickness, uniform cable structure, and tight bonding between different layers. For example, a well - manufactured cable will have a seamless insulation layer, which reduces the risk of water ingress and other weather - related damage.

Performance in Different Weather Conditions

Rain and Moisture

One of the most common weather challenges for cables is rain and moisture. 0.6 - 1kv YJV cables are designed to withstand water penetration. The XLPE insulation has low water absorption properties, which means that it can prevent water from reaching the conductors. The PVC sheath further acts as a barrier, protecting the insulation from direct contact with water. However, in long - term submersion situations, additional protection such as waterproofing coatings or special cable designs may be required.

Extreme Temperatures

0.6 - 1kv YJV cables can operate within a wide temperature range. The XLPE insulation can withstand high temperatures without significant degradation. In high - temperature environments, the cable's electrical properties remain stable, ensuring reliable power transmission. On the other hand, in cold weather, the cables are flexible enough to be installed and used without becoming brittle. The PVC sheath also helps in maintaining the cable's flexibility at low temperatures.

UV Radiation

Exposure to UV radiation can cause degradation of cable materials over time. The XLPE insulation in 0.6 - 1kv YJV cables has good UV resistance. However, if the cables are installed outdoors for an extended period, a UV - resistant outer sheath can be added for extra protection. This prevents the sheath from cracking and peeling, which could expose the insulation to other environmental factors.

Wind and Physical Impact

Strong winds and physical impacts can cause mechanical stress on the cables. The PVC sheath of 0.6 - 1kv YJV cables provides some degree of mechanical protection. It can resist abrasion and minor impacts. In areas prone to high winds or where there is a risk of physical damage, armoured versions of the cables, such as Armoured YJV Cable, can be used. The armour layer, usually made of steel wires or tapes, adds extra strength and protection against mechanical damage.

Comparison with Other Cable Types

When compared to other cable types, 0.6 - 1kv YJV cables generally offer better weather - resistance. For example, some traditional rubber - insulated cables may have lower resistance to moisture and UV radiation. The XLPE insulation in YJV cables provides a more stable and durable solution in various weather conditions.

Specific Applications and Weather - Resistance Requirements

In different applications, the weather - resistance requirements of 0.6 - 1kv YJV cables vary. For indoor applications, the cables may not be exposed to extreme weather conditions, so the standard weather - resistance features are usually sufficient. However, for outdoor applications such as in power distribution networks, industrial parks, or construction sites, the cables need to be more weather - resistant.

Maintenance and Inspection

To ensure the long - term weather - resistance of 0.6 - 1kv YJV cables, regular maintenance and inspection are necessary. This includes checking for any signs of damage to the sheath, such as cracks or cuts, and inspecting the insulation for signs of moisture ingress. If any damage is detected, it should be repaired or the cable replaced promptly.
